At Soucy, you will play a vital role in supporting and improving manufacturing practices. Your analytical skills will be crucial as you tackle technical issues, analyze root causes, and participate in product trials. Collaborating within the production team, you'll ensure seamless adjustments to maintain high production standards.
Key Responsibilities:
• Respond to technical quality and performance issues
• Analyze root causes and meticulously document findings
• Participate in trials for new products and process improvements
• Validate production processes and equipment usage
• Support continuous improvement training initiatives
Requirements:
• DEC in plastics technology or mechanical engineering
• Relevant hands-on manufacturing experience
• Strong analytical skills for effective troubleshooting
• Excellent communication and collaboration abilities
• Proactive mindset focused on solutions
